一、介绍

DataGrip 版是由 JetBrains 公司(就是那个出品 Intellij IDEA 的公司)推出的数据库管理软件。如果你不爱折腾的话,这家公司出品的很多 IDE 都是你的最佳选择,比如你进行 Python 开发的可以选择 JetBrains 全家桶中的 PyCharm 。

DataGrip 支持几乎所有主流的关系数据库产品,如 DB2、Derby、H2、MySQL、Oracle、PostgreSQL、SQL Server、Sqllite 及 Sybase 等,并且提供了简单易用的界面,开发者上手几乎不会遇到任何困难。

下载DataGrip 下载链接如下 Download DataGrip: Cross-Platform IDE for Databases & SQL

安装过程也很简单,双击安装,下一步,中间会让你选择主题,安装完成后,启动,界面如下(我这是汉化后的)

二、连接数据库

相信使用过 IDEA 的同学看到这个界面都会感到很亲切。File->DataSource :配置数据源

DataGrip 支持主流的数据库。你也可以在 Database 视图中展开绿色的+号,添加数据库连接

选择需要连接的数据库类型,这里以MySQL为例

Driver 部分显示数据库驱动信息,如果还没有下载过驱动,底部会有个警告,提示缺少驱动

注意:首次连接不会显示所有数据库,需要用户简单操作一下,右击1/10,如图,先择所有即可:

三、常用操作

sql语句编写

DataGrip 的智能提示非常爽、非常爽、非常爽,无论是标准的 sql 关键字,还是表名、字段名,甚至数据库特定的字段,都能提示,不得不感叹这智能提示太强大了,Intellij IDEA 的智能提示也是秒杀 eclipse。

数据库导出

这些基本功能的设计、体验,已经惊艳到我了,接下来就是数据的导出。

DataGrip 的导出功能也是相当强大

选择需要导出数据的表,右键,Dump Data To File

即可以导出 insert、update 形式的 sql 语句,也能导出为 html、csv、json 格式的数据

也可以在查询结果视图中导出

小技巧

快速使用列名:

Alt+Enter两次,即可:

最后推荐给大家一个非常适合学习IT技术的平台,小石云课堂

特点:

一、办公软件、开发软件、毕业设计软件,会员即可全年免费下载;

二、在线免费精品体验课看不停,Python小白到大神、0基础入门数据分析、Excel办公提升、Python办公自动化、Python爬虫技术,总有适合你的那一个。

小石云课堂,宗旨:让更多的人,轻松学技术;

官方网址: 小石云-轻松学技术xiaoshiykt.com

【数据库】对不起navicat我投入了DataGrip的怀抱相关推荐

  1. 对不起navicat我投入了DataGrip的怀抱

    一 前言 今天的内容是知识追寻者想给大家安利一个软件为DataGrip, 没错,他就是idea,pycharm们的兄弟,都是属于jetbrains家族,知识追寻者放弃navicat的使用了,对不起na ...

  2. 本机未装Oracle数据库时Navicat for Oracle 报错:Cannot create oci environment 原因分析及解决方案

    本机未装Oracle数据库时Navicat for Oracle 报错:Cannot create oci environment 原因分析及解决方案 参考文章: (1)本机未装Oracle数据库时N ...

  3. 常用开发工具 之 SQLite 数据库 与 Navicat for SQLite 的下载、安装与简单使用说明

    常用开发工具 之 SQLite 数据库 与 Navicat for SQLite 的下载.安装与简单使用说明 目录 常用开发工具 之 SQLite 数据库 与 Navicat for SQLite 的 ...

  4. mysql数据库应用软件navicat快捷键

    mysql数据库应用软件navicat快捷键 navicat快捷键 ctrl+F 搜索本页数据 Ctrl+Q 打开查询窗口 Ctrl+/ 注释sql语句 Ctrl+Shift +/ 解除注释 Ctrl ...

  5. 数据库工具Navicat闪退

    数据库工具Navicat闪退 因为有道词典的"自动取词"功能 关闭有道词典或者关闭有道词典的自动取词功能.

  6. MySQL新建数据库+用Navicat查看MySQL的方法

    MySQL新建数据库 数据库启动有问题的,见本人另外一篇博客:启动MySQL:net start mysql出现问题+本地Mysql忘记密码的修改方法 目前的用户名和密码都是root(因为好记!) 打 ...

  7. navicat 8 mysql生成关系_MySQL数据库通过navicat建立多对多关系

    ** 构建两张表的多对多关系:清洗数据表(clean_data表)与用户表(user表)建立多对多的关系.如下图图0所示 图0 多对多之间关系 1 创建表 .打开navicat,创建三张表,clean ...

  8. 【数据库】Navicat Premium12远程连接MySQL数据库

    00. 目录 文章目录 00. 目录 01. 环境介绍 02. Navicat安装 03. MySQL开启远程登录权限 04. Navicat连接MySQL 01. 环境介绍 Navicat版本: N ...

  9. 【数据库学习】——数据库可视化--Navicat下载安装连接教程

    目录 进入网站 下载可视化软件 安装 双击桌面图标,选择试用 连接数据库 查看数据库中的表,如下所示 常用数据库有: MySQL.sqlite等 进入网站 Navicat | 产品https://ww ...

最新文章

  1. 通过Anaconda在Ubuntu16.04上安装 TensorFlow(GPU版本)
  2. bat脚本监控tomcat并启动_Windows server利用批处理脚本判断端口启动tomcat的方法
  3. idea 提升幸福感 常用设置(重装机配置)
  4. 天气模式_北方降雪骤减!南方开启湿冷模式多阴雨!|天气展望
  5. dajngo电商数据库设计图,通用版本
  6. HTML5移动端最新兼容问题解决方案
  7. CF991C Candies
  8. 黑马程序员---三天快速入门Python机器学习(第一天)
  9. 软件工程需求分析-需求规格说明书
  10. K8S集群部署istio
  11. Spring Boot 实现在线Web SSH( Java Web版本的Xsehll)
  12. android多国语言包命名规则
  13. 讯飞语音离线版本集成
  14. wow插件实现优雅的动画页面
  15. .NET 开源项目推荐之 直播控制台解决方案 Macro Deck
  16. Jetpack Compose——Icon(图标)的使用
  17. 小程序实现商城案例(赋源码)
  18. 数据库是如何通过索引定位数据,索引的原理讲解
  19. 2023年南京晓庄学院五年一贯制专转本国际经济与贸易专业考试大纲
  20. python学习之 利用蒙特卡洛方法计算PI值

热门文章

  1. c语言贪吃蛇大作业报告,C语言贪吃蛇实验报告
  2. CMU 15-445实验记录(三):Project 2 B+Tree的插入与删除
  3. Hold Time违例,该如何解决
  4. 用python爬取网站_「自如网」关于用python爬取自如网信息的价格问题(已解决) - seo实验室...
  5. 简单好玩的vue小游戏,网页小游戏
  6. 键盘点击事件 vue iview ui
  7. linux做视频 加字幕,ubuntu16.04给视频添加字幕方法 ubuntu16.04如何给视频添加字幕...
  8. 智能化LED照明技术的最新发展
  9. RFID射频技术基本原理与射频技术中的基本单位
  10. python下载谷歌地图瓦片_python抓取天地图瓦片